The story of the red cotton tree in my village.
Hello everyone. From january to february every year, the red cotton tree, which is the symbol of the village where I live, blooms and falls to the ground. Thai people call the red cotton tree the "ton Ngiao". And my village is named after this kind of tree in thai language pa ngiao village. Because my village has 2 red cotton trees that are over 100 years old. In the past before this village was built, this area had many the red cotton trees and only 2 trees remained until now and it is the symbol of this village.
The two red cotton trees in my village are very tall and large. In january and february, kids and villagers scramble to pick the blossoms of the red cotton tree that has fallen from the tree to the ground. But the villagers and children had fun and enjoyed with scramble the flowers of the red cotton tree. I think it's more like a village play than a race to win. Some people pick up the flowers of the red cotton tree to sell. But some people pick up the flowers of the red cotton tree for cooking.
After picking the flowers of the red cotton tree, the petals must be plucked and the pollen of the flower dried for several days in the sun until the pollen withered. When the pollen of the flower has withered, it can be sold or used for cooking.
The pollen of the red cotton tree flower can be used to cook thai food which is a popular dish in the north of thailand. This menu is called kanom jeen nam ngiao. Delicious local food of the northern people of thailand.
